摘要
Background: Increased tryptase concentrations are a risk marker for the severity of reactions to Hymenoptera stings or venom immunotherapy. Objective: To investigate serum tryptase concentrations in beekeepers with and without Hymenoptera venom allergy (HVA). Methods: Serum tryptase concentrations were measured in adult patients with HVA (n=91, 37 of whom were beekeepers), beekeepers without HVA (n=152), and control individuals from the general adult population (n=246). Results: Multivariate analyses revealed that serum tryptase levels were positively associated with beekeeping activities (P<.001) and HVA (P<.001). Tryptase levels were also positively associated with age (P<.001) and male sex (P=.02), and negatively associated with alcohol consumption (P=.002). Conclusions: Beekeeping and HVA are independently associated with increased concentrations of serum tryptase.
